SCORCHING temperatures definitely put the “summer” into Springvale’s Summer Community Festival at Burden Park on the weekend.
As temperatures neared 40 on Saturday, the majority of the crowd waited until the sun went down and the mercury retreated before enjoying the free entertainment.
Culturally diverse food stalls once again proved a hit, as did the talent quest, live music and the fear-inducing amusement rides.
But the highlight of the night was the fireworks, the biggest pyrotechnic display in Springvale all year.
